Merge branch 'tipc-next'



Jon Maloy says:

====================
tipc: bug fixes and improvements

Intensive and extensive testing has revealed some rather infrequent
problems related to flow control, buffer handling and link
establishment. Commits ##1 to 4 deal with these problems.

The remaining four commits are just code improvments, aiming at
making the code more comprehensible and maintainable. There are
no functional enhancements in this series.

v2: Fixed a typo in commit log #2. Otherwise no changes from v1.
